Candlebuddy Posted November 16, 2005 Share Posted November 16, 2005 I just bought a new silicone mold to make a pillar candle. I plan on using KY votive/pillar wax in the mold. The person who makes the mold, uses paraffin and she uses an LX18 to wick the pillar. Does anyone use LX wicks in soy? Just wondering if anyone can help me out here? TIA. Jeana Posted November 16, 2005 Share Posted November 16, 2005 I use an LX 24 in a blend of KY and Ecosoya for my 3" pillars. I'm assuming you got a 3' mold? Ky is really soft so you may want to try an LX 22 to start with.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
